I see fine with my glasses, yet would be considered legally blind without them. I make a point of occasionally practicing without my glasses (but, yes, WITH safety goggles!) at targets up to 7 yards.

The reason is that I might find myself having to fight without my glasses (either from them being knocked off at the start of the fight or being surprised while sleeping) and it's good to practice such scenarios.
